The Hard Quartet – a new indie rock supergroup composed of Emmett Kelly, Stephen Malkmus, Matt Sweeney, and Jim White – have released their debut single. It’s called ‘Earth Hater’, and it arrives with a claymation music video directed by Eyedress. The group has also announced their first three live shows, which are set to take place in Los Angeles, New York, and London this fall. Check out ‘Earth Hater’ and find the list of dates below.

Chelsea Wolfe has announced a new EP, UNDONE, which arrives on August 30 via Loma Vista. It features remixes of songs from her latest album, She Reaches Out to She Reaches Out to She, by ††† (Crosses), Full of Hell, Justin K Broadrick (Godflesh), Boy Harsher, Forest Swords, and more. Listen to ‘Tunnel Lights (††† Remix)’, featuring vocals from Chino Moreno, below.
“She Reaches Out felt like the perfect record to have official remixes for since it’s themed so heavily with transformation,” Wolfe said in a statement. “I called in some artists I really respect to expand upon the sonic universe we created with Dave Sitek and it’s been such a treat and delight to hear each song come back transformed!”

Pom Pom Squad have announced their sophomore LP, Mirror Starts Moving Without Me. The follow-up to 2021’s Death of a Cheerleader comes out October 25 via City Slang Records. It’s already been previewed by last month’s ‘Downhill’, and a new single called ‘Spinning’ is out today, along with a video directed by frontperson Mia Berrin and Benjamin Lieber. Check it out below and scroll down for the album cover and tracklist.
“The song represents a moment when I was learning to cope with painful memories of the past and how they’ve shaped my future,” Berrin said in a statement about ‘Spinning’. “In accepting them, I’ve been able to find more freedom and forgiveness within myself.”
“A lot of the lyrics on the album have to do with watching/analyzing yourself, so I knew I wanted to create a surveillance room setup for something,” she added of the accompanying visual. “It turned out to be a really fun home-base for the ‘Spinning’ video.”
Opening up about the album, Berrin shared: “I took a lot of inspiration from my younger self on this album. I wanted to get back in touch with my creative roots. After hitting a particularly rough bout of writer’s block, I challenged myself to make a playlist of my all-time favorite songs from childhood to adulthood. It was healing in a way I didn’t expect! Before we went into the studio I made my bandmates and Cody do the same, then we all listened to each other’s and had a long conversation about them. Through the sessions for Mirror we were all pulling references from our collective playlists more than anything else.”
Christopher Owens has returned with ‘I Think About Heaven’, the former Girls frontman’s first new music in seven years. The single artwork, photographed by longtime collaborator Sandy Kim, features Owens outside the Wolf’s Lair Castle in Los Angeles, home of the late Shelley Duvall. Listen below.
Owens’ last solo release was 2017’s Vante by Curls. In the years since, he has faced significant personal challenges, including a motorcycle accident, battles with homelessness, and the loss of former Girls bandmate Chet “JR” White.

In this dynamic field, Suyu Chen stands out with her distinctive approach. Her recent collection, “A Study of Snow,” epitomizes this fusion of tradition and innovation. Chen’s jewelry reflects a contemplative exploration of man-made objects discarded and buried in deep snow. Her pieces, characterized by bold, chunky forms and matte white surfaces marked by scratches that reveal subtle, layered colors underneath, capture the essence of abandoned landscapes. Suyu’s recent invited show, Cluster Jewellery Fair in London, has presented this series of contemporary jewelry titled ‘A Study of Snow’. The collection has been travelled to various countries, first showcased in the Gioielli in Fermento 20/21 exhibition in Milan, Italy, then it had been to China for Beijing International Jewellery Exhibition, among many more destinations. Chen’s work demonstrates her ability to navigate between tradition and contemporary craft practice.

Born in 1992 in Guangzhou, China, Suyu witnessed the development of factories and the evolution of craft industry in the area. Influenced by contemporary artists such as Agnes Martin and Sol LeWitt, Chen’s jewelry pieces narrate a dialogue between industrial materials and the human touch. Through subtle color changes and meticulous mark-making on the material surface, she invites wearers to contemplate the delicate balance between art, craft, and personal expression. Each piece tells a story of transformation, taking inspirations both from the natural world and man-made items.

From her studies at the Guangzhou Academy of Fine Arts, China, to earning her Master of Fine Arts at the Rochester Institute of Technology, US, the artist often explores raw materials and found objects, while merges uncommon materials with traditional metalsmithing. In Chen’s current work, the combination of PVC and silver is the most appealing and innovate element. Through her unique crafting and coloring process on plastic pipe and precious metals, Chen always gave her one-of-a-kind piece an elegant and minimal look with a sense of serenity and comfort from a nature-inspired color plate. Exhibiting her works locally and internationally over 40 times, including in North America, Europe and East Asia, has allowed her to engage with diverse audiences and cultural perspectives, enriching her artist practice.

Yuxuan Li, an accomplished guzheng artist, is proud to announce the release of her new EP, “First Note Guzheng.” This collection brings together five timeless traditional Chinese guzheng pieces: 渔舟唱晚 (Fishing Boat Nocturne), 高山流水 (Mountain and Flowing Water), 苏武思乡 (Su Wu Homesick), 出水莲 (Water Lotus), and 广陵散 (Guangling Tune). Each piece in this EP reflects the profound influence that these historical compositions have had on Yuxuan Li’s artistic journey.
Residing in the bustling cities of New York and Los Angeles, Yuxuan has found joy in sharing her love for the guzheng within the diverse cultural landscape of the United States. As an independent musician, performer, and educator, she focuses on fostering cultural exchange and understanding through her music. Her approach to her art is characterized by a gentle curiosity and a respect for tradition, blended with a modest desire to explore new musical horizons. She has collaborated with local artists, experimenting with the guzheng in hip-hop and jazz settings, creating innovative performances that blend traditional Chinese music with contemporary genres.”These traditional pieces are the foundation of my artistry,” Yuxuan Li explains. “Each composition tells a unique story and carries the essence of Chinese musical heritage. By interpreting these masterpieces, I aim to honor the past while bringing their timeless beauty to a contemporary audience.”

The EP opens with 渔舟唱晚 (Fishing Boat Nocturne), a serene and evocative piece that captures the tranquility of a fisherman’s evening. This is followed by 高山流水 (Mountain and Flowing Water), which represents the profound connection between nature and music, a theme that resonates deeply with Yuxuan musical styles, 苏武思乡 (Su Wu Homesick) conveys the poignant emotions of a historical figure’s yearning for his homeland, showcasing Yuxuan Li’s ability to express deep emotional narratives through the guzheng.
出水莲 (Water Lotus) is a delicate and graceful piece that symbolizes purity and renewal, reflecting Yuxuan Li’s innovative approach to traditional music. The EP concludes with 广陵散 (Guangling Tune), a dramatic and powerful composition that highlights Yuxuan Li’s technical prowess and interpretative depth.
With “First Note Guzheng,” Yuxuan Li not only showcases her technical skill and expressive range but also bridges the gap between ancient traditions and modern listeners. Each track is a testament to the enduring power of traditional Chinese music and Yuxuan Li’s dedication to preserving and revitalizing this rich cultural heritage.

“Fallen Leaves” stands out not only for its deep connection to traditional guzheng music but also for its innovative blend of contemporary piano elements, reflecting Yuxuan Li’s background in piano studies. The piece uses a lot of traditional guzheng playing techniques such as 泛音 (harmonics), 滑音 (glissando), and 多指摇指 (multi-finger tremolo), seamlessly integrated with three-against-two rhythms commonly found in contemporary piano compositions. This fusion creates a unique soundscape that captures the essence of autumn, with its themes of change, reflection, and renewal, echoing the timeless beauty of the traditional pieces while introducing Yuxuan Li’s distinct musical voice. With “Fallen Leaves,” Yuxuan Li not only honors the legacy of traditional Chinese music but also contributes to its ongoing evolution.
